*Mayer Hashi Program Intervention for contraception use in Bangladesh (Rahman et al., 2014)

ID: 
RMNCH106
Full title: 
Impact Evaluation of the Mayer Hashi Program of Long-Acting and Permanent Methods of Contraception in Bangladesh
Publication date: 
01 July 2014
Maps: 
Social, Behavioural and Community Engagement Interventions for Reproductive, Maternal, Newborn, Child Health
Social, Behavioural and Community Engagement Interventions for Reproductive Health
Study design: 
Difference-in-Differences (DID)
Regions: 
South Asia
Countries: 
Bangladesh
Population: 
Healthy timing and spacing of pregnancy
Interventions: 
IPC and mass media and entertainment education
Outcomes: 
Knowledge and attitudes of health providers for community engagement
Family planning method use
Perception of quality of care / Satisfaction with services
Provider communication and engagement skills
